This morning I woke up at noon. I brushed my teeth, played a Miles Davis CD, drank some hot chocolate and fell asleep again. The second coming was at three PM. My cat’s tail whipped back and forth slapping me in the face with each whip. It was a silent protest to a food forgotten afternoon. She looked back when I opened my eyes as if she heard my eyelashes separating. I bid her good morning and after a short little stretch she forgave my all-too-soon of a catnap and headed towards my face for some mutual head rubbing. I looked outside and what would otherwise have been grapevines, peppers, and bright tomatoes in the summer was a densely white barren uninviting place. I was expecting Chewbacca and Hans Solo to ride by in a snow glider at any moment. I thought to myself how much of a boring fucking day it was going to be. After all it was a “state of emergency” but I figured that after all of the terrorist alerts of the summer, they were probably once again crying wolf and trying to condemn us to home bound boredom. So I then trooped it to Central Park with my best friend for some picture taking and I ended up having my first ever sledding experience. Wow! I had a great time. I hit a tree three times, good thing that it had hay around its base. I also knocked some poor guy, who looked as if he already had a bad run, right on his ass, where he then got kicked in the head by some kid doing fifty in an unregistered sled, poor guy but better him then me. Central Park was beautiful, it was simply amazing. It was the stuff of post cards. I almost want to cancel my meeting tomorrow just to be able to get some more trips down that hill or maybe find one that’s even steeper or higher. What an amazing time! I must have zoomed down that hill like fifty times. Needless to say, my ass is killing me. “State of Emergency”, my ass, well, yeah, I guess that exactly what it’s in.
